About this role

## Responsibilities - Lead data migration and deduplication workstreams for the Fraud Prevention System 2 (FPS2) program at CMS. - Design and execute end-to-end data migration pipelines to move legacy fraud-related data into a cloud data warehouse (Snowflake). - Perform deduplication and record consolidation across multiple CMS source systems (e.g., provider, beneficiary, and case/referral records). - Develop and maintain ETL/ELT workflows using modern tooling (e.g., DBT, Apache Airflow, SnapLogic) for continuous ingestion and transformation. - Conduct data profiling, quality analysis, and validation across source and target environments to ensure accuracy and completeness. - Define and implement matching/resolution logic to identify and merge duplicate records across consolidated systems. - Collaborate with CMS stakeholders, data architects, and fraud analysts to understand source data models and define target-state mappings. - Create data lineage documentation and migration runbooks to support governance and audit requirements. - Tune and optimize Snowflake objects (tables, views, tasks, pipes, clustering keys) for performance and cost efficiency. - Support data cutover planning and execution, including rollback procedures and validation checkpoints. ## Qualifications - Minimum experience requirements: - 16+ years with BS/BA; or - 14+ years with MS/MA; or - 10+ years with Ph.D. - Demonstrated experience executing large-scale data migrations. - Proficiency in SQL and at least one scripting language (Python preferred). - Hands-on experience with ETL/ELT tools (e.g., DBT, Apache Airflow, Informatica, SSIS, SnapLogic). - Experience with data quality validation, reconciliation testing, and migration verification in complex, multi-source environments. - Familiarity with CMS or federal government data environments, including data governance and security requirements. - Ability to obtain or maintain a Public Trust suitability determination. ## Nice-to-Have - Direct experience on a CMS program. - Experience with deduplication or entity resolution techniques. - Familiarity with CMS claims, provider enrollment, or beneficiary data structures. - Experience with master data management (MDM) tools/frameworks. - Familiarity with fraud, waste, and abuse (FWA) detection workflows and data models. - Experience delivering in Agile/Scrum environments (e.g., Jira, Confluence). ## Salary - **$135,000 – $216,000** (typical range). Final compensation depends on factors such as scope, experience, education, skills, location, and contract considerations. ## Company Peraton is a next-generation national security company and enterprise IT provider delivering mission-focused solutions for government agencies.
